The Type 2 Diabetes Score in 50131, Johnston, Iowa is 91 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

93.22 percent of the population in 50131 drive to work alone. 0.22 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 87.91 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 1.13 percent of the residents in 50131 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.43 members with about 2.15 cars available per household.

An estimate of 95.46 percent of the residents in 50131 has some form of health insurance. 25.45 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 82.93 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 50131 would have to travel an average of 39.62 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Guthrie County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 50131, Johnston, Iowa.

As of , an estimate of 23,577 residents live in 50131 with a median age of 37.6 years. 28.64 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 14.90 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 40.35 percent of the residents in 50131 is currently married, and 16.73 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 50131 is $10,292.33.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 50131 is approximately $1,386. The median household spends about 13.47 percent of their income on housing.

Type 2 Diabetes is a chronic condition that affects the way the body metabolizes sugar (glucose). It is characterized by insulin resistance and high blood sugar levels. Managing Type 2 Diabetes requires regular medical care, including visits to healthcare providers such as primary care physicians, endocrinologists, and diabetes educators. For individuals with Type 2 Diabetes, consistent access to healthcare is essential for managing their condition and preventing complications.

The financial cost of missing a provider's appointment for individuals with Type 2 Diabetes can be significant. Missed appointments can lead to poorly managed blood sugar levels, which increases the risk of complications such as heart disease, stroke, kidney disease, and nerve damage. Moreover, untreated or poorly managed diabetes can result in higher healthcare costs due to emergency room visits and hospitalizations.
